Why is a check valve required at the inlet of single-disc floating roof drainage pipes in GB 50341, while it is not necessary for double-disc floating roof drainage pipes?
Reply #22024-02-26
The requirement in standard GB 50341 for installing check valves on single-disc floating roof drainage pipes is aimed at preventing the floating roof from sinking due to the loss of buoyancy in case of abnormal conditions inside the floating roof tank (such as a drop in the liquid level). In such situations, the check valves prevent external liquids or gases from flowing back into the tank, thus protecting the structure of the tank and the contents stored within it. As for the reason why a check valve is not required in double-disc floating roof drainage pipes, it is because the design of a double-disc floating roof itself consists of an inner floating roof and an outer floating roof, which together form a sealed space. This sealed space helps to reduce evaporation losses, and to some extent, it allows the pressure within this space to compensate for changes in external pressure. Therefore, there is no need for a check valve to prevent backflow of external liquids or gases, as is the case with single-disc floating roofs. .
